                        <content:encoded><![CDATA[Hey, Ive recently gotten a great book on guitar wiring, and I'd like to start experimenting.  Since this is my first time I don't want to work on my current guitar incase i mess up, so I want to find a cheap junker to practice on.<br><br>I want to find a guitar that has two humbuckers ( not single coils as I'm practicing for a les paul), 2 tone knobs, 2 volumes, and a 3 way selector switch, and has the ability to hold strings.  I don't plan on ever really playing this guitar, I just want to test out my wiring skills.  I plan to rip put all the wiring and try wiring the guitar from scratch.  Don't care how bad it sounds, i just need something cheap.<br><br>Any idea where i could get something like that for as cheap as possible?
